PNP officer killed in Masbate clash
04/24/2007 | 06:17 PM
A police officer was killed in an encounter with suspected communist rebels in a remote village in the central Philippine province of Masbate early Tuesday morning, a regional military spokesman said.
About 5 a.m., combined military and police elements engaged 100 New People's Army (NPA) rebels in Bugtong village in Mandaon town, resulting to the death of police Inspector Harold Gaces, said Lt. Col. Rhoderick Parayno, spokesman of the Armed Forces Southern Luzon Command (Solcom).
Casualties on the enemy side was undetermined although their were traces of blood seen on the escape route taken by the insurgents, Parayno said.
The body of Gaces was retrieved about 9 a.m. and later brought to Mandaon town proper for post-mortem examination and proper disposition.
Troops have since launched pursuit operations against the rebels. - GMANewsTV
